免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e如何制作图标

在Windows系统中,EXE文件的图标是让用户更直观地识别该程序或应用的功能并提供良好的视觉体验。创建EXE文件图标需要一定的技巧和工具辅助。在这篇文章中,我们将详细介绍EXE文件的图标制作方法和原理。

制作EXE文件图标的步骤:

1. 准备图标文件:首先,我们需要设计一张图片作为程序的图标。通常情况下,图标是一个正方形的图片,其大小可以是16x16、24x24、32x32、48x48、64x64、128x128、256x256等像素。建议使用.ico格式,这是Windows系统中专用于图标的文件格式。

2. 图标制作工具:你需要一个能够处理和编辑.ico文件的图标制作工具。以下是一些建议使用的工具和方法:

- Photoshop (安装ICO格式插件)

- GIMP (安装ICO格式插件)

- IcoFX:一款独立的图标制作工具。

- 在线图标制作网站如:https://www.icoconverter.com 或 https://www.iconfinder.com.

3. 修改图标文件:使用上述工具打开你选择的.ico文件,对其进行编辑,并将其保存为新的.ico文件。

4. 整合图标到EXE文件:要将.ico文件添加到EXE文件中,我们需要借助一款资源编辑器,例如Resource Hacker。以下是使用Resource Hacker整合图标到EXE文件的方法:

a) 下载并安装Resource Hacker:访问 http://www.angusj.com/resourcehacker ,下载并安装该软件。

b) 打开程序:安装完成后,运行Resource Hacker程序。

c) 打开EXE文件:点击菜单栏的“File”选项,选择“Open”,然后浏览你的电脑目录,选中你需要修改图标的EXE文件。

d) 添加.ico文件:展开左侧窗格中的“Icon”或“Icon Group”目录,选择其中的一个资源,然后右键点击,选择“Replace Icon”。对话框中点击“Open file with new icon”按钮,找到你的.ico文件,选择它。点击“Replace”。

e) 保存修改后的EXE文件:点击“File” -> “Save As”,为修改后的EXE文件选择一个保存路径。这将生成一个新的EXE文件,而不会覆盖原始文件。

恭喜你,现在你已经成功为你的EXE文件制作并添加了一个新的图标!

原理:

EXE文件中的图标实际上是储存在文件的资源部分(Resource Section)的数据。Windows操作系统在加载EXE文件时,会读取资源部分中与图标相关的数据,并根据这些数据在桌面和文件资源管理器中展示图标。资源编辑器(如Resource Hacker)实际上是读取和修改了EXE文件资源部分的内容,来实现添加、删除和替换图标等操作。


相关知识:
exe计算软件怎么制作
制作exe计算软件需要一定的编程知识和相关技能。在本教程中,我将详细介绍如何创建一个简单的exe计算软件。我们将使用Python编程语言和其流行的库pyinstaller来创建此程序。步骤一:安装Python环境1. 访问Python官网(https://
2023-04-27
exe做什么工具
在计算机编程中,exe 文件(扩展名为 ".exe")全称为可执行文件(executable file),它是一种特别的文件类型,用于存储由某种程序设计语言编写的程序或应用软件,在 Windows 操作系统中,它们被用来执行不同的任务。一般来说,exe 文
2023-04-27
c++制作exe
C++制作可执行文件(EXE)的详细介绍在计算机编程中,可执行文件(EXE)是一个包含可以由计算机执行的指令的文件。C++是一种编程语言,可以用来编写程序,并将其转换为EXE文件。本文将对C++制作EXE文件的过程和原理进行详细介绍。1. 编写C++源代码
2023-04-27
应用程序打包成一个exe
将应用程序打包成一个可执行文件(exe)是一种常见的做法,它可以方便地在计算机上运行应用程序,而无需安装其他依赖项。本文将介绍打包应用程序的原理和详细步骤。一、原理将应用程序打包成一个exe的原理是将所有的应用程序文件和依赖项打包到一个可执行文件中,使得在
2023-04-14
将网站封装为exe
将网站封装为exe的过程,其实就是将网站打包成一个可执行文件(exe文件),使得用户可以直接双击打开网站,而无需通过浏览器访问。这种方式的优点在于,用户可以在没有网络的情况下,直接打开网站,同时也可以避免用户忘记网站的地址或者被篡改等问题。下面是将网站封装
2023-04-14
web项目打包成exe
将web项目打包成exe是一种将网站应用程序转换为可执行文件的技术,这样可以使应用程序更加方便地在本地计算机上运行,而无需通过浏览器访问。本文将为您介绍将web项目打包成exe的原理和详细过程。一、原理将web项目打包成exe的原理是将网站应用程序转换为一
2023-04-14
web网站打包exe
将Web网站打包成可执行文件(.exe)可以使得用户可以在没有网络连接的情况下使用网站,并且可以更直接地访问网站,而无需打开浏览器。本文将介绍如何将Web网站打包成可执行文件,并探讨其原理。一、打包工具有很多工具可以将Web网站打包成可执行文件,如Elec
2023-04-14
vue前端打包成exe
将Vue前端打包成EXE是一种将Vue应用程序转换为可执行文件的方法,以便在没有安装Node.js或其他依赖项的情况下运行应用程序。在本文中,我们将介绍Vue前端打包成EXE的原理和详细介绍。1. 原理Vue前端打包成EXE的原理是将Vue应用程序打包成单
2023-04-14
mac好用的开发软件
作为一名开发者,选择一款好用的开发软件是非常重要的。对于Mac用户来说,选择一款适合自己的开发软件也是非常必要的。下面是我推荐的几款Mac好用的开发软件。1. XcodeXcode 是苹果公司推出的一款开发工具,是开发Mac OS X和iOS应用的主要工具
2023-04-14
linuxls
ls是Linux系统中的一个常用命令,用于列出目录中的内容。在Linux系统中,一切皆文件,因此ls命令可以用来查看文件和目录。本文将详细介绍ls命令的原理和使用方法。一、ls命令的原理ls命令的原理很简单,它通过读取文件系统中的目录信息来列出目录中的内容
2023-04-14
exe软件生成
Exe软件生成是指将程序源代码转换成可执行文件的过程。在Windows操作系统中,exe文件是最常见的可执行文件格式。exe软件生成过程可以分为编译、链接和打包三个阶段。编译阶段是将源代码转换成汇编代码的过程。源代码是由程序员编写的高级语言代码,比如C、C
2023-04-14
cygwin打包exe
Cygwin是一个在Windows平台上实现了POSIX(可移植操作系统接口)的开源软件,它提供了一些Linux/Unix系统中常用的命令和工具,使得在Windows平台上能够更方便地进行Linux/Unix开发和运行。在Cygwin中,用户可以使用类似于
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4